M’luru: Police arrest three for gambling
Team Udayavani, Mar 16, 2023, 1:18 PM IST
Police on Thursday arrested three persons for their alleged involvement in matka gambling.
Praveen (33), a resident of Kotekar, Manoj George Noronha (43), a resident of Kudupu Nadumane and Rakesh (47), a resident of Gorigudde Nehru Road were arrested from a building near Ambedkar Circle in the city.
Police seized Rs 3000 cash, two mobile phones, two computers and other equipment used for the gambling game. The total value of these items is estimated to be Rs 75,000.
The operation was conducted under the leadership of ACP Mahesh Kumar.
